Abstract

The CO2concentration is increasing annually, and therefore reducing CO2emissions is of uttermost con-cern. Steel slags may be used to overcome this issue, as they are suitable for mineral carbonation and CO2capture due to their high CaO content. Accordingly, mineral carbonation may not only permanently captureCO2molecules, but also might produce valuable and thermodynamically stable organic and inorganic mate-rials. Mineral carbonation is conducted in industrial plants designed on purpose, but they have limitations. Thus, fountain confined conical spouted beds may be suitable for mineral carbonation and CO2capture, but there is hardly any information regarding their applications in mineral carbonation. Accordingly, a thorough characterization of steel slags has been carried out in order to shed light onto mineral carbonation in spouted beds.
